There are several educational requirements to become a presenter. Presenters usually study psychology, business, or education. 62% of presenters hold a bachelor's degree, and 20% hold an master's degree. We analyzed 12,266 real presenter resumes to see exactly what presenter education sections show.

| Presenter education level | Presenter salary |
|---|---|
| Master's Degree | $48,122 |
| High School Diploma or Less | $39,815 |
| Bachelor's Degree | $44,415 |
| Doctorate Degree | $51,328 |
| Some College/ Associate Degree | $42,750 |
